Task prioritisation is a critical project management practice that helps teams focus their efforts on the most important and time-sensitive work. By assigning priority levels to tasks, you create a clear hierarchy of urgency and importance that guides daily work decisions, resource allocation and attention distribution across your project portfolio.

Effective priority management requires consistent criteria for determining task urgency and importance. Teams should establish clear guidelines for when to use each priority level, avoiding the common pitfall of marking too many tasks as critical, which dilutes the effectiveness of the prioritisation system and creates unnecessary pressure on team members.
